I was told (by a HD dude) that there is a storm door manufacturer that puts permanent vents at the top and bottom of one of their storm door models to provide "chimney-like" venting of the space between the "real" door and the storm door. (The door sales guy can't remember the manufacturer .... of course) My door faces South and the heat build-up warped the original fiberglass/plastic mouldings around the window panes in the entrance door.....I have since made wood mouldings up special and replaced the original moulding, and that works fine. I would really like to get rid of the intense heat in that space though.....the "full view" storm sash I have in the current storm door is really more for looks than anything else + I have film on it to prevent fading of the entrance door.

Anyone know of such a vented storm door? The only one I have been able to "Google Up" has a monster vent clear across the bottom (looks bad) and no "outlet" at the top!

If I could round up some brass bezels, I believe I could drill and install several small, round, screened vents myself.....but I would need a few "courage pills" before taking a sawhole drill to a new door :o)
